Bunka no Hi, or Japanese Culture Festival, is a free cultural festival dedicated to celebrating, commemorating and educating the public about Japanese and Japanese American Culture in the Seattle area. This year it’s going virtual. During the celebration families can learn about Japanese and Japanese American history and culture including Seattle’s Japantown (Nihonmachi), manga graphic novels, storytelling (kamishibai), taiko performances, mochi pounding (mochitsuki) and Japanese new year’s mochi soup (ozoni).
